pmic如何控制三色灯
时间: 2024-02-13 09:59:49 浏览: 137
用PLC控制三彩灯闪烁电路
PMIC可以通过控制GPIO口来控制三色灯。三色灯通常有三个引脚,分别对应红色、绿色和蓝色的LED。通过控制这三个引脚的电平,就可以控制三色灯的颜色。下面是一个简单的示例代码:
```
void set_led_color(int red, int green, int blue)
{
/* 设置红色LED的电平 */
pmic_gpio_set_value(red_gpio, red);
/* 设置绿色LED的电平 */
pmic_gpio_set_value(green_gpio, green);
/* 设置蓝色LED的电平 */
pmic_gpio_set_value(blue_gpio, blue);
}
```
这个函数接受三个参数,分别对应红色、绿色和蓝色的LED的电平。通过调用`pmic_gpio_set_value()`函数,可以设置GPIO口的电平,从而控制LED的亮灭。在实际应用中,需要根据具体的PMIC和LED硬件来编写相应的代码。
阅读全文